Choosing the Right Cabling Types for Surveillance Systems
The infrastructure of surveillance systems heavily relies on the type of cabling used. Different cabling types offer specific advantages:
Cat5e vs. Cat6 vs. Cat6a
Cat5e: Typically supports bandwidths up to 100 MHz and is suitable for most residential installations.
Cat6: Supports bandwidths up to 250 MHz and is better suited for commercial environments requiring higher data speeds.
Cat6a: Offers up to 500 MHz, making it ideal for large sports facilities that require extensive data transmission.
Fiber Optic Cabling
Fiber optic cabling is especially beneficial for large sports complexes due to its ability to transmit data over long distances with minimal signal degradation. It’s perfect for linking disparate parts of a vast facility.

Benefits and Drawbacks of Different Surveillance Systems
Every system comes with its pros and cons that dictate suitability for specific environments:
IP Cameras
Benefits: High-resolution footage, remote access, easy scalability.
Drawbacks: Higher initial cost and requires dependable network infrastructure.
Analog Cameras
Benefits: Lower cost and simple setup.
Drawbacks: Limited video quality and more complicated to scale.
